How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Henley Meadows?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Henley Meadows Studio Apartments | $1,380 | $875 | $2,155 |
Henley Meadows 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,600 | $874 | $3,908 |
Henley Meadows 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,864 | $950 | $4,295 |
Henley Meadows 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,299 | $1,549 | $9,186 |
